Добавить дополнительные строки, обусловленные значениями столбца - PullRequest
0 голосов
/ 11 февраля 2019

У меня есть фрейм данных с item, number_of_repeats (время повторения строк), row_vale_string (значение строки в таблице результатов, разделенных запятыми).

У меня есть другой фрейм данных, в которомвсе items перечислены в смешанном порядке.Я бы хотел

а) ДОБАВИТЬ количество строк = total_repeats;

b) для каждой строки оставьте item как есть

c) добавьте row_value из row_value_string.

Я ищу решение dplyrдля этого.

Item    total_repeats   row_value_string 
101     4               1,2,3,4 
102     2               1,2 
103     4               1,2,3,4 
104     1               1 
105     7               1,2,3,4,5,6,7 
101     4               1,2,3,4 
102     2               1,2 
103     4               1,2,3,4 
104     1               1 
105     7               1,2,3,4,5,6,7

Результат будет выглядеть так:

item    row_value
101        1
101        2
101        3
101        4
102        1
102        2
103        1
103        2
103        3
103        4
104        1
105        1
105        2
105        3
105        4
105        5
105        6
105        7
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...